On today’s episode, I’m joined by Ashlee Adams, founder of The Aussie Coeliac. We chat about her early coeliac disease diagnosis, her journey growing up gluten free in a time when awareness and products were scarce, and how her experiences shaped her role in the food industry and inspired her to create a trusted online resource for the gluten free community.

Ashlee was diagnosed with coeliac disease in 1998 at just six years old. She recalls the challenges of navigating a world with limited gluten free options and awareness, which motivated her to start sharing recipes, reviews, and helpful information online. Today, The Aussie Coeliac is a valuable resource for many Australians living gluten free, providing support, tips, and delicious gluten free inspiration.
